How Data Analytics Is Revolutionizing The Healthcare Industry

The healthcare industry is undergoing a profound transformation, driven by advancements in data analytics. By leveraging vast amounts of data, healthcare providers can improve patient care, optimize operations, and drive innovation.
Enhancing Patient Care
Data analytics is playing a pivotal role in enhancing patient care by enabling personalized treatment plans and improving clinical outcomes. By analyzing patient data, healthcare providers can gain insights into disease patterns, predict patient outcomes, and tailor treatments to individual needs.
Data analytics can help identify patients at risk of developing chronic conditions such as diabetes or heart disease, allowing for early intervention and preventive care. This personalized approach leads to better health outcomes and reduces healthcare costs. Advancing Medical Research
Data analytics is revolutionizing medical research by enabling researchers to analyze large datasets and uncover new insights into disease mechanisms, treatment efficacy, and patient outcomes. This accelerates the pace of medical discoveries and drives innovation in the healthcare industry.
Data analytics can help identify genetic markers associated with specific diseases, leading to the development of targeted therapies. Additionally, by analyzing clinical trial data, researchers can gain insights into the effectiveness of new treatments and optimize study designs. Addressing Privacy and Security Concerns
While data analytics offers numerous benefits, it also raises important privacy and security concerns. Healthcare data is highly sensitive, and ensuring its protection is paramount. Healthcare providers must implement robust data security measures and comply with regulations such as the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A).
Data analytics can help identify potential security threats by analyzing access patterns and detecting anomalies. This proactive approach enhances data security and protects patient privacy. Embracing AI and Machine Learning
The integration of AI and machine learning with data analytics can revolutionize various aspects of healthcare. These technologies can automate data analysis, providing faster and more accurate insights. For example, AI can analyze medical images to detect diseases such as cancer, while machine learning algorithms can predict patient outcomes based on historical data.

Overcoming Implementation Challenges
Implementing data analytics in healthcare is not without its challenges. Healthcare providers must address issues such as data integration, data quality, and interoperability to fully leverage the potential of data analytics.
Integrating data from multiple sources, such as electronic health records (EHRs), laboratory systems, and medical devices, can be complex. Ensuring data quality and consistency is also critical for accurate analysis.
